The foundation of GENERON®’s technology stems from Dow Chemical’s Polymer Research Group, which
screened hundreds of polymers in the 1970’s and 1980’s before selecting the optimum combination of
gas permeability and selectivity. This polymer work has allowed GENERON® to lead the industry in the
delivery of high productivity nitrogen solutions for over 40 years.

GENERON holds 15 patents covering the process of converting the polymer into hollow fibers about the
size of a human hair. Specialized technology is required to balance fiber strength and gas flow
characteristics to optimize fiber performance.

GENERON holds 20 patents covering the technologies used to bundle our polymeric fiber into
completed modules. Each module has more than 1-million fibers and critical that each fiber is bundled in
a way that ensures each fiber contributes to the gas separation process.

Membrane Technology

How does a membrane work?

The membrane separation of gases is simple in concept.


At the heart of technology are polymeric membrane
materials that allow for the rapid passage of one gas
while minimizing the passage of another. The GENERON®
Membrane is a solubility and diffusivity driven process
directly proportional to the partial pressure differences of
components in the feed and permeate gas streams. The
GENERON® high performance membrane maximizes the
passage of waste gases while keeping the nitrogen loss to
a minimum. GENERON maintains reliability unmatched in
the industry!

GENERON®’s polymer has the best properties for allowing


the fast gases to permeate the membrane relative to the
slow gases, resulting in the most efficient membrane
performance and lowest unit power consumption.

The membrane module contains millions of fibers.


Compressed feed air is passed down the bores of the
fibers at one end of the module with the enriched
nitrogen gas exiting from the opposing end. Oxygen and
water vapor are selectively removed and vented away
from the feed air as it flows to the other end of the
module.

The Membrane Flow Diagram below, demonstrates the relative rates of common gases with the focus on
the separation of oxygen and water vapor from compressed air to provide a high-purity nitrogen
product stream. The GENERON® polymer has the best properties for allowing O2 & H2O to permeate
preferentially through the membrane walls relative to the N2 and inert Air. GENERON® Membranes
deliver the most efficient air separation membrane performance and the lowest unit power consumption
